China had released the second batch of refined oil export quotas with the total volume of 12 million tonnes, up 100% year on year, as the first batch of refined oil export quotas was to be basically used up, according to OilChem's survey.
The volume of quota includes 9 million tonnes for refined oil and 3 million tonnes for bunker fuel.
Compared with the same batch in 2022, the volumes of PetroChina, Sinopec, CNOOC and Sinochem were all sharply increasing, and Zhejiang Petroleum & Chemical, China North Industries Group and China National Aviation Fuel Group (CNAF) had also obtained quotas , data from the Ministry of Commerce showed.
China's 2023 Second Batch of Refined Oil Export Quotas (Unit: '000 tonnes)
Enterprise | General Trade | Processing Trade | Bunker Fuel | Total |
PetroChina | 2,630 | 0 | 1,270 | 3,900 |
Sinopec | 2,050 | 1,500 | 1,440 | 4,990 |
CNOOC | 840 | 0 | 250 | 1,090 |
Sinochem | 1,000 | 0 | 10 | 1,010 |
China National Aviation Fuel | 30 | 0 | 0 | 30 |
Zhejiang Petroleum&Chemical | 830 | 0 | 30 | 860 |
China North Industries Group | 120 | 0 | 0 | 120 |
Total | 7,500 | 1,500 | 3,000 | 12,000 |
Source: Ministry of Commerce
The Second Batch of Refined Oil Export Quotas in 2022 and 2023 (Unit: '000 tonnes)
Enterprise | 2023 | 2022 | YoY Chg |
PetroChina | 2,630 | 1,530 | 72% |
Sinopec | 3,550 | 2,400 | 48% |
CNOOC | 840 | 420 | 100% |
Sinochem | 1,000 | 150 | 567% |
China National Aviation Fuel | 30 | 0 | - |
Zhejiang Petroleum&Chemical | 830 | 0 | - |
China North Industries Group | 120 | 0 | - |
Total | 9,000 | 4,500 | 100% |
Source: Ministry of Commerce and OilChem
